American Chopper Consumer Products & Branding
American Chopper was a reality TV show centered around a family business that manufactured custom chopper motorcycles.
I was responsible for translating the hit television show into a global product line for mass market and owned the visual brand strategy and design direction.
I developed style guides, packaging, signage, and marketing materials. Oversaw the design direction of product development from concept through final on-shelf placement for more than 375 product skus at retail. Ensured the development of a cohesive product line across categories including apparel, publishing, automotive, toy, home décor, and more. I collaborated with manufacturers, external design teams, and illustrators. The book “American Chopper: At Full Throttle” was on the New York Times Best-Seller List in 2005.
